Quick Transport Summary: Phumi Moreal to Siem Reap
- Transport Type: Local Minibus
- Ticket Price: USD 5 per person (Paid directly to the driver)
- Journey Duration: Approx. 2.5 hours (Distance is around 100 km)
- Booking Method: Easily arranged through your local guesthouse in Phumi Moreal (Sayong)
- Pickup Logistics: Door-to-door service (The driver picks you up directly at your accommodation)
Road Conditions Between Phumi Moreal and Siem Reap

The road from Phumi Moreal to Siem Reap is about 100 km. We were informed that a new road had been opened so we could expect a comfortable ride.
How to Book a Minibus from Phumi Moreal to Siem Reap

There is a minibus service to Siem Reap and when asked at the guesthouse, the driver said he will pick us up at the guesthouse between 7am and 8am.
Locals also seem to have a system of calling the driver directly to be picked up.
The fare from Phumi Moreal to Siem Reap is USD 5 per person. It is paid directly to the driver.
Morning Pickup Logistics and the Journey
We were told that the minibus would pick us up between 7am and 8am and indeed the bus arrived a little after 7am. There were already a few local passengers on board.

The minibus picked up pre-booked passengers along the way. Everyone was ready, apart from a young couple who we had to wait about 15-20 minutes for.
Arrival in Siem Reap: Duration and Drop-off Experience
We got off in Siem Reap, just a short distance from our Guest House. It was only 9.30 am and so the trip took about 2.5 hours. Great deal all around!
